Hong Kong Stock Exchange-listed company IVD Medical Holdings has announced the acquisition of $19 million worth of ETH.

By: theblockbeats.news|2025/08/08 10:31:54

BlockBeats News, August 8th. According to CoinDesk, Hong Kong-listed company IVD Medical Holdings announced the purchase of $19 million (about 149 million Hong Kong dollars) worth of Ethereum to support its medical asset tokenization strategy. The company is developing the ivd.xyz platform based on Ethereum smart contracts, aiming to achieve the tokenization of drug intellectual property and medical assets.
